Do the public security organs have the right to handle economic disputes?

1. Road blockages caused by human factors fall within the scope of the traffic police department’s responsibilities.

The traffic police department has the right to inspect and punish traffic violations due to intentional road blockage, suspected of disrupting public order and endangering road traffic safety.

2. The state explicitly prohibits public security organs from intervening in economic disputes.

For public security agencies to intervene in economic disputes, the Ministry of Public Security has issued the "Notice of the Ministry of Public Security on Strictly Prohibiting Intervention in Economic Disputes Beyond Their Authority", the "Notice of the Ministry of Public Security on Strictly Prohibiting Public Security Organs from Intervening in Economic Disputes and Arresting People in the Law of the People" and "The Ministry of Public Security "Notice of the Ministry of Public Security on No Illegal Interference in the Handling of Economic Dispute Cases by Public Security Agencies". It requires that those in charge of public security organs who treat economic disputes as fraud cases and fail to correct them should be held accountable and exposed through the news media.

3. Economic disputes belong to the category of civil litigation.

There are two major categories of economic disputes:

The first is economic contract disputes. Such as sales contract disputes, loan contract disputes, undertaking contract disputes, construction project contract disputes, technology contract disputes, etc.;

The second is economic tort disputes. Such as intellectual property (such as patent rights, trademark rights) infringement disputes, ownership infringement disputes, business rights infringement disputes, etc. In a market economy, a contract is a legal and universal form for establishing transaction relationships between equal market entities, jointly implementing transaction behaviors, and pursuing and realizing economic goals. Among them, contract disputes are the main part of economic disputes.

In summary, economic disputes belong to the category of civil litigation and should be resolved by the parties through litigation procedures in the People's Court. Road blockages caused by human factors will be dealt with by the traffic police department for illegal activities that endanger road traffic safety, but the public security organs have no right to intervene in specific economic disputes.
